Transaction 81cc5c777f970a823570179d704c2b51ab33ede7d75d24bab5090a175b473c28
1 Input
1 Output
-
81cc5c777f970a823570179d704c2b51ab33ede7d75d24bab5090a175b473c28:0
- value
- 907659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1889cf58e79d79e17d0b89db4952a345bd19ee35 OP_EQUAL
- address
- 33vmEMJfw8HHyi7RMXcGsoHpo6XJkKig8B